Rutstroemia (?) on Camellia leaves
Nick Aplin, 28-07-2015 23:46

Salut à tous,


 


Yesterday I found many apothecia of this interesting species on fallen leaves of Camellia japonica They measure up to 1.8 mm and had short stalks (up to 1mm). They were present on almost every leaf I inspected.


Asci IKI BB, croziers not observed (despite intense searching...)


Ascospores 9.8 - 11.9 x 5 - 6 µm, usually with two very large guttules and several smaller ones, with delicate sheaths which quickly disappear in water.


Paraphyses with a long, continuous vacuole (as in Mollisia)


Flank cells often with brown encrustation, and with large refractive vacuoles which quickly collapse and turn brown.


My specimen seems quite close to R.'kalevi' , though the ascospore dimensions are just a little different, as is the guttulation (and substrate). I'll come back later with some photos of  ascus bases.


Am I thinking along the right lines? Has anyone collected anything similar on Camellia?

Lothar Krieglsteiner, 29-07-2015 06:33
Lothar Krieglsteiner
Re : Rutstroemia (?) on Camellia leaves

I have no idea what species it could be - Camellia is a substrate not growing in Central Europe. But I think it is a Sclerotiniaceae because of the type of apical apparatus. And - yes - why not Rutstroemia? The spores are fully guttulate and elongate, and the macroscopical appearance could fit.

Masanori Kutsuna, 29-07-2015 08:58
Re : Rutstroemia (?) on Camellia leaves
Hello Nick

I collected similar disco on Camellia japonica in Japan, relatively common in summer.
Ascospores of Japan materials, 10.2-12.8 x 4.5-5.6 ?m, seem pale brown after discharge.

Hans-Otto Baral, 30-07-2015 07:11
Hans-Otto Baral
Re : Rutstroemia (?) on Camellia leaves
Interesting indeed! Absence of croziers is rather rare in sclerotiniaceous fungi, and the excipulum of t. angularis exceptional within Rutstoemia (though occurring in R. bolaris).

So we should know quite enough about this species - maybe Japanese workers (Tsuyoshi Hosoya, Yanjie Zhao) could help? I will send them a link.
